#2436a4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2436a4 is composed of 14.1% red, 21.2%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78% cyan, 67.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 231.6 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 39.2%. #2436a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#486cff with #000049.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#2436a4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2436a4 has RGB values of R:36, G:54,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 2373284.

Shades and Tints of #2436a4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f2f3fc is the lightest one.
